Okay, if he has a knife, or gun, YOU GET OUT OF THERE as fast as your legs will carry you! But, what if that's impossible?

Chuck Repscher (Black Belt in Combat Hapkido) teaches Combat Hapkido Weapons Defense on the 1st and 3rd Friday of every month - 6:30-7:30PM (for men and women aged 13 - 100). Says Chuck, "I plan on doing basic Combat Hapkido weapons disarming techniques. We'll will start warming up with kicking, rolling and striking. I'm covering, knife, handgun, long gun and stick defenses. I also review basic joint locks when I do weapons, as this helps build a student's Joint lock arsenal.

No prior martial arts experience is necessary! Come in the shape you're in!

Classes will be held at Green Hill Martial Arts. First class is freen Drop in fee after that, for just the one class is $15. Become a member for access to all of our classes.
